The Impact You'll Have
This position provides leadership and oversight for enterprise-wide quality program management activities that support quality improvement, accreditation readiness, regulatory compliance, and strategic priorities across all lines of business. The role partners with leaders and stakeholders across the organization to strengthen quality governance, oversee quality committees and work plans, ensure compliance with NCQA, CMS, DHS, MDH, and other regulatory and accreditation requirements, and drive continuous improvement through effective planning, monitoring, documentation, and cross-functional collaboration.What You'll Do
